2-2. Making Use of USB (Universal Serial Bus)

This monitor has a hub compatible with USB. Connected to a PC compatible with USB or another USB
hub, this monitor functions as a USB hub allowing connection to peripheral USB devices.

Required system environment

• A PC equipped with a USB port or another USB hub connected to a USB compatible PC
• Windows 10 / Windows 8.1 / Windows 8 / Windows 7 / Windows Vista / Windows XP, or Mac OS X
10.2 or later
• USB cable
Attention
• This monitor may not work depending on PC, OS or peripheral devices to be used. For USB compatibility of
peripheral devices, contact their manufacturers.
• Devices connected to the USB downstream port still work when the monitor is in power saving mode or when
the power is switched off using only the power button of the monitor. Therefore, power consumption of the
monitor varies with connected devices even in the power saving mode.
• When the main power switch is Off, device connected to the USB port will not operate.
